Transaction 90aa62c440b9721f0b96bd3b1c446433c8e75974d181ab360ccd96ba75810e2a
1 Input
1 Output
-
90aa62c440b9721f0b96bd3b1c446433c8e75974d181ab360ccd96ba75810e2a:0
- value
- 301454
- script pubkey
- OP_0 OP_PUSHBYTES_32 abdd6e4561880a73d4d19ca24312a084da91988e39ca18d16973cbada89cfc36
- address
- bc1q40wku3tp3q9884x3nj3yxy4qsndfrxyw889p35tfw096m2yulsmqwef7t2